About Jodene Cilliers
Founder and Partner :Specialises in Estate Planning. Head of the Estate Planning Department.
Other focuses: Oversees the Conveyancing Department.
Qualifications: B.Com Law Degree, LLB Degree, Higher Diploma in Tax Law.
Registered Practising Attorney with the Legal Practice Council.

As the founder, Jodene opened the offices of Cilliers Attorneys™ in 2014 at the age of 31. At the time, she was a first-time Mom, with a three-month-old baby in tow. In an industry that makes it impossible to have a healthy work-life balance, being flexible and available to her child and future children was important to Jodene. This need to be available to her family, together with her Husband's full support and the faith that the Lord would be by her side, gave Jodene the courage to start her own firm. Her Husband joined the firm as a Law Partner three years later in 2017. This was to enable Jodene to have even more flexibility and time with her children, whilst he assisted in the managing, growing and running of the firm. Jodene has recently and proudly celebrated the 10th Anniversary of the law firm. Due to her qualifications and her wide range of experience in various fields of law, she has created a formidable reputation for herself in the legal fraternity. Jodene's modern-day thinking combined with her knowledge, professionalism, integrity and passion for law has made her a force to be reckoned with. She has set a precedent for other female attorneys in the industry that strive for a healthy work-life balance in law. Jodene has shown many of her colleagues that it is possible to achieve success in law and provide high-quality work to clients, whilst prioritising family life.
Education
LLB Degree (UJ)- Four Year Honours Degree
B.Com Law Degree (UJ) Three Year Degree - majoring in business management, economics and law
H.Dip Tax Law (UJ) - Two Year Higher Diploma- Jodene studied this two year higher diploma simultaneously with her last two years of her LLB degree and was the youngest student in her class;
Completed the compulsory PVT (practical vocational training) in terms of the Legal Practice Act;
Completed competency-based examinations for admission as an attorney (board exams);
Admitted Attorney in South Africa;
Obtained Rights of Appearance in the High Court;
Completed the PMT (legal practice management course) required by the LPC, as a law firm owner.

2008-2009
-
Attended to Third Party Motor Vehicle claims for the largest insurance companies in South Africa and managed the trials thereof from the drafting of the letter of demand, to the issuing of summons, up to and including the final judgement and/or settlement at court.
-
Attended to obtaining various default judgements at both the Johannesburg High Court and Pretoria High Court. Liaised with the Registrars of the High Court.
-
Appeared weekly at court in front of various Magistrates and managed some of the motion court rolls for her firm. The following motion court rolls were her responsibility to manage and to appear at on behalf of her firm: Johannesburg Magistrate Court, Boksburg Magistrate Court, Benoni Magistrate Court, Randburg Magistrate Court and on a few occasions the Alberton Magistrate Court, Springs Magistrate Court and Kempton Magistrate Court.
-
Attended to various foreclosure auctions across Gauteng at the relevant Sheriff's offices, as a representative of the top South African banks. She ensured the relevant bank obtained the required price at the auction and would bid on their behalf.
-
Attended to maintenance issues at the Johannesburg Family Court.
-
Attended to the taxing of bill of costs in front of the Taxing Master at both the Johannesburg High Court and Pretoria High Court.
-
Mentored by a tax advocate, assisted in the drafting of tax opinions, attended various meetings with clients in relation to tax issues and attended meetings at SARS offices on behalf of clients.
